Strong’s Definitions

πάντοθεν pántothen, pan-toth'-en; adverb (of source) from G3956; from (i.e. on) all sides:—on every side, round about.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 2x

The KJV translates Strong's G3840 in the following manner: on every side (1x), round about (1x).

STRONGS G3840:
πάντοθεν (πᾶς), adverb, from Homer down, from all sides, from every quarter: Mark 1:45 L T WH Tr (but the last named hem πάντοθεν; cf. Chandler § 842); Luke 19:43; John 18:20 Rec.bez elz; Hebrews 9:4.
THAYER’S GREEK LEXICON, Electronic Database.
